Gameplay footage from Valve’s in-development hero shooter Deadlock leaked today, revealing for the first time many of the game’s rumored new features and characters, including its much-discussed monorail-like transportation system.

The clip, posted by insider PlayerIGN on X (formerly Twitter) on May 22, shows off a small preview of Deadlock in its current early alpha. The player can be seen using a zipline that loops around the ceiling of the map, which looks like a fantasy-steampunk version of New York. The footage was shot in a "Hero Training" mode without hostile players or AI bots.

The HUD renders also show a four-lane layout, seemingly confirming rumors that Deadlock took inspiration from Dota 2 and SMITE, where one team must capture or destroy landmarks that lead to the other team's base. Early leaks dating back to May 17th mention a variety of elements and gameplay pulled from the MOBA genre, and it's clear from the footage that this will certainly be the case when it comes to Deadlock's objectives.

The character is then seen using a segmented agility or dodge bar, which has a set cooldown, while firing a steampunk-inspired pistol. We've already gotten a look at the character roster and taken a deeper look at Grey Talon, an arrow-wielding hero not too dissimilar to Overwatch's Hanzo, so we can expect a variety of different weapon types and ammo.
